The Synthesis of a π-Extended Tetrathiafulvalene Porphyrin for MOF Formation and Use in Solar Cells [PDF]
With the purpose of creating a conjugated system for potential experiments in solar cell applications, the first π-extended TTF (ExTTF) porphyrin with a functionalizable handle (carboxylic ester) was synthesized. The overall yield was 0.249%.

Reactions of HNO with Metal Porphyrins: Underscoring the Biological Relevance of HNO [PDF]
Azanone (1 HNO, nitroxyl) shows interesting yet poorly understood chemical and biological effects. HNO has some overlapping properties with nitric oxide (NO), sharing its biological reactivity toward heme proteins, thiols, and oxygen.

meso-5,15-Bis[3-(isopropylidenegalactopyranoxy)phenyl]-10,20-bis(4-methylphenyl)porphyrin
The crystal structure of a glycosylated porphyrin (P_Gal2) system, C70H70N4O12, where two isopropylidene protected galactose moieties are attached to the meso position of a substituted tetraaryl porphyrin is reported.
